Who Are SiteOne Landscape Supply’s Main Customers?

Understanding the customer demographics and target market of a landscape supply company like SiteOne Landscape Supply is crucial for strategic planning. SiteOne primarily focuses on business-to-business (B2B) sales, specifically targeting landscape professionals. This focus allows the company to tailor its products and services to meet the specialized needs of this industry.

The core target market includes landscape contractors, irrigation contractors, golf course superintendents, and other green industry professionals. These customers require a wide array of products, from irrigation supplies and fertilizers to hardscapes and outdoor lighting. SiteOne also provides value-added services such as design support and business management tools, enhancing its appeal to these professionals.

While specific demographic data like age, income, and education levels are not publicly detailed, the typical customer profile involves experienced professionals with specialized trade skills. These businesses range from small, owner-operated firms to large commercial enterprises. The company's strategic moves, such as the 2024 acquisition of Timberwall, demonstrate a focus on expanding into specialized segments, further refining its customer base.

Where does SiteOne Landscape Supply operate?

The geographical market presence of SiteOne Landscape Supply is substantial, with a wide network of branches across North America. The company's operations are primarily concentrated in the United States and Canada, targeting areas with high construction and landscaping activity. This strategic distribution enables SiteOne to effectively serve its customer demographics and meet the demands of its target market.

SiteOne Landscape Supply has a strong market share and brand recognition in many regions, particularly those with established residential and commercial landscaping industries. This widespread presence is a key factor in its ability to cater to diverse customer needs and preferences. By understanding the nuances of each region, SiteOne tailors its product offerings to align with local demands, climate conditions, and architectural styles.

The company's approach involves local teams that understand the specific needs of their market, ensuring that SiteOne Landscape Supply can provide relevant products and services. This localized strategy is supported by recent expansions and acquisitions, such as the acquisition of Timberwall in early 2024, which strengthens its presence in key markets and expands its product categories. This strategic focus on geographical distribution has contributed to consistent growth, with net sales reaching $4.2 billion in fiscal year 2023.

How Does SiteOne Landscape Supply Win & Keep Customers?

The company, a leading landscape supply company, employs a comprehensive strategy for acquiring and retaining customers. Their approach combines traditional and digital marketing, sales tactics, and value-added services. This multi-faceted strategy is designed to build strong customer relationships and drive consistent growth within the landscaping industry.

Their customer acquisition efforts are driven by a strong branch network, industry presence, and targeted digital marketing. They focus on reaching landscape professionals through various channels, including their website, email marketing, and social media. Sales tactics involve direct engagement, field visits, and personalized consultations to understand and meet specific project requirements. They aim to provide solutions tailored to the needs of their target market.

Customer retention is a key focus, supported by loyalty programs and personalized service. The company leverages customer data and CRM systems for targeted marketing and product recommendations. Technology, such as the mobile app, enhances customer experience. These strategies have contributed to consistent net sales growth, with the company reporting $4.2 billion for the fiscal year 2023.
